Caption

Penalty enhancer for crimes committed by a person acting as an agent of a foreign government or terrorist organization with the intent to silence or punish persons for their political view, criminalizing the enforcement of foreign laws without federal or state approval, and providing a penalty. Impact

The implications of SB650 on state law are substantial as it reinforces the state's authority to regulate activities involving foreign entities. By imposing strict penalties on actions associated with foreign interference, the bill aims to deter such actions and uphold the free expression of political views within the state. This could lead to heightened scrutiny of individuals with ties to foreign governments, reflecting an increasing concern over national security and political freedom.

Summary

SB650 aims to enhance penalties for crimes committed by individuals acting as agents of foreign governments or terrorist organizations, particularly when such actions are intended to silence or punish individuals for their political viewpoints. This legislation addresses the intersection of foreign influences and domestic law enforcement by criminalizing the enforcement of foreign laws without explicit federal or state approval. The bill is positioned as a measure to protect political expression and ensure that no external entity can impose legal consequences on U.S. citizens for their political beliefs.

Contention

While proponents of SB650 argue that it is necessary to safeguard against foreign manipulation and protect individual rights, critics raise concerns about potential overreach and the implications for political discourse. Some fear that the bill may be used to disproportionately penalize individuals based on their political beliefs or associations, leading to chilling effects on free speech. The balance between protecting national interests and preserving civil liberties is a central point of debate surrounding the legislation.
